Union Minister Kiren Rijiju commented on the Supreme Court's decision to grant interim bail to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al. "The Supreme Court has granted the bail. However, he (Arvind Kejriwal) hasn't been acquitted. The Supreme Court has not declared the arrest as illegal. It has just granted the bail as the case has been referred to the larger bench," Rijiju stated. He emphasized that the interim bail should not be interpreted as an exoneration, as the legal process is still ongoing.
